ABSTRACT:
A circuit for indicating status of a component of a computer system includes a first indicator (D1), a second indicator (D2), a power supply (V), a first transistor (Q1), and a second transistor (Q2). The first indicator includes a positive end and a negative end. The second indicator includes a positive end connected with the negative end of the first indicator, and a negative end connected with the positive end of the first indicator. The power supply is connected to the positive end of the first indicator via a first resistor, and connected to the positive end of the second indicator via a second resistor. The first transistor is connected between the negative end of the first indicator and a ground, and the second transistor is connected between the negative end of the second indicator and the ground.
